Proposal

Notification of intent to carry out Tree Surgery Works to No. 6 Trees within a Conservation Area. T1 holly - trim all over by approximately 0.5m to maintain a hedge form. T2 conifer - as t1. T3 ash, t4 Holm oak, t5 & t6 ash - re-pollard to previous pollard points

About tree works applications

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.
